针对人工喷施秸秆青贮添加剂不能满足秸秆饲料质量要求及劳动强度大等问题,基于单片机AT89S52设计了一种添加剂变量喷施控制系统。该系统通过对秸秆揉切机喂入辊开度和主轴转速变化信息进行采集和处理,进而根据处理结果调节脉宽调制信号的占空比,控制喷头的喷施量。经MATLAB对系统进行仿真,结果表明:系统响应时间为0.38s,超调量约为18.0%,稳态误差在±2.0%以内,能够满足混合喷施的要求。
Aimed at the problems that artificial spraying of straw silage additives has been far from adequate to meet the quality requirements of straw forage and labor intensity was great,this paper designed a variable spraying control system of silage additives on the basis of singlechip AT89S52.The variable information of inlet roller opening and cutter spindle speed of straw kneading machine was collected and processed,according to which to adjust the duty cycle of PWM and control the flow rate.The system was simulated successfully with the MATLAB platform.The results show that response speed is 0.38s;overshoot is about 18.0%;steady state error is within ±2.0%,which can meet the requirement of mixing spraying according to definite proportion.
